TDengine is a time-series database optimized for Internet of Things devices. Prior to 3.4.1.15, source/libs/transport/src/transComm.c transDecompressMsg() read STransCompMsg.contLen when pHead->comp == 1 without first validating that the RPC packet contained the 8-byte STransCompMsg structure, causing an unauthenticated out-of-bounds read, uncontrolled allocation, integer underflow, and server crash. This issue is fixed in version 3.4.1.15.
